What is Benchmarking Employee Compensation?
Benchmarking employee compensation involves comparing your organization’s salary and benefits packages to those offered by similar companies in the same industry or geographic location. This process helps employers determine if their pay scales are competitive, ensuring they can attract and retain skilled employees. Utilizing a PEO simplifies this by providing access to extensive compensation data and industry standards.

Steps to Benchmark Employee Compensation with a PEO
Following a structured approach will ensure effective benchmarking. Here’s how to do it:
- Identify Key Job Roles: Determine which employee positions are critical to your organization’s success and need to be benchmarked.
- Engage with Your PEO: Collaborate with your PEO to access compensation data that matches your industry, company size, and geographic location.
- Analyze Data: Compare your current compensation levels to the benchmarks provided. Look for trends in salary ranges, bonuses, and benefit offerings.
- Make Informed Adjustments: Based on the analysis, adjust your compensation structures to align with the benchmarks, ensuring you remain competitive within your market.
- Establish Ongoing Benchmarking Practices: Set up a system for regular reviews to ensure your compensation packages evolve with industry standards.

Frequently Asked Questions
What types of data can a PEO provide for benchmarking?
A PEO can provide data on salary ranges, benefits, bonuses, and compensation trends across various industries, helping businesses understand the competitive landscape.
How often should I benchmark my employee compensation?
It is advisable to benchmark compensation annually or whenever there are significant changes in your industry or business operations to remain competitive.
